Property Description for 120 East 87th Street, P-8H

Perfect pied-a-terre near Central Park. Dramatic duplex junior 1 bedroom located in a luxury Upper East Side condominium building. This lofty apartment impresses with double-height ceilings and a meticulous renovation. Southern light fills the space through a wall of windows overlooking the quiet building courtyard. Expertly designed with a large sleeping area or den upstairs, a generous living/dining area downstairs, and ample storage space throughout. There are thoughtfully built-out closets and tucked-away storage cabinets to maximize space both downstairs and up. The kitchen features stainless steel appliances, including a Subzero refrigerator, Miele cooktop and hood, as well as a dishwasher and space-saving microwave oven, all in an understated color palate with neutral stone tile backsplash and countertops. The bathroom was finished with beautiful mosaic tile work, quartz countertops, an under-mounted sink, adjustable Hansgrohe rain shower, and a wall-mounted towel warmer. The apartment also boasts hardwood floors and a state-of-the-art Lutron lighting system, including electronic solar and blackout shades. There is a laundry room on the floor. Park Avenue Court is a full-service condominium with round-the-clock doorman and desk staff, as well as amenities including a renovated swimming pool and health club with yoga room, planted courtyard, parking garage, and a children's playroom. Convenient to the express subways and buses on 86th Street, Whole Foods, countless restaurants, museums, schools, and a short stroll to Central Park. Pet friendly.

Quick Profile

Exuding a cosmopolitan, refined air that is reminiscent of Paris or other European cities, the Upper East Side (the UES, to local cognoscenti) has a reputation as being a bastion of wealth and privilege. Even though it was built by American “royalty” families like the Vanderbilts, Roosevelts, Kennedys, Carnegies and Rockefellers, whose elaborate mansions once anchored Fifth Avenue, there are affordable housing options throughout the neighborhood. The further east you move, away from Central Park and the more commercial avenues, the more likely you are to find quiet, tree-lined streets with historic townhouses and brownstones. Keep your eye out for reasonably priced apartments in pre-war low-rise and even a few high-rise buildings.

With abundant, beautifully landscaped green spaces, including the oasis of Central Park acting like a backyard, the area is quiet and lushly green. You can relax and unwind in John Jay Park, Carl Schurz Park or take a stroll along the East River Promenade. The whole neighborhood seems isolated from the workaday chaos of the city at large. Add to that the history of the neighborhood and the abundance of cultural institutions, and you have a uniquely welcoming neighborhood.

Known for its abundance of high-end retail shopping, especially on Madison Avenue, the Upper East Side is host to the Barneys New York flagship department store. Here you can find upscale goods, fashion and home decor items. You will also find the edgy runway-inspired Alexander McQueen collections. If you are dying to treat your feet to red-soled opulence, be sure to visit the Christian Louboutin boutique. These are only a small sampling of this high-end shopper’s paradise that features everything from designer boutiques that offer the ultimate in haute couture to resale shops where you can find last season’s best on sale at hefty discounts .

There are many unique dining experiences, from fine dining to the casual bite-on-the-go, awaiting you in the UES. Sushi is going through a renaissance in the city, and the best omakase-style sushi can be found at Sasabune on E 73rd Street. Omakase sushi means that you leave the choice of ingredients, preparation method and presentation to the chef. Elegant French cuisine can be experienced at JoJo, E 64th Street, housed in gorgeous townhouse. Just for fun, visit the Lexington Candy Shop on Lexington Avenue, to get a taste of an old-fashioned soda fountain.
